George: As you know, I wasn't the guy who introduced you to the Draytek range, but I too use them now in three locations. Although I had some issues with VPN some while ago, I managed to resolve these in the last few days - one of the ISP's was telling porkies, and the IP proved to be dynamic. By the use of an on-line IP utility, the IP appears to be static, and all the issues have been resolved. The web interface is easy with JAWS, and one of the units (which cost well over a hundred quid) survived the power surge which killed off a PC 7 weeks or so ago. The PCMCIA card in my lap top was also easy to set up.
